Skip to main content

RulesEngineEvaluator

RulesEngineEvaluator = (facts: Record<string, unknown>) => Consequent[]

Defined in: rules-engine/src/types/export.ts:26

In-process evaluator returned by formatRulesEngine(re, 'native'). Given a facts object, returns the react-querybuilder!Consequent consequents of every condition that fires, in order, honoring the react-querybuilder!RulesEngine.evaluationMode evaluationMode.

Parameters

ParameterType
factsRecord<string, unknown>

Returns

Consequent[]


caution

API documentation is generated from the latest commit on the main branch. It may be somewhat inconsistent with official releases of React Query Builder.